Exactly. Volunteering is about giving to others. Most places that accept volunteers do so because they can't afford to pay people for the work, usually because they're non-profits.

I volunteer for a non-profit that does work in a field that interests me. As much as I'd love to work for them, they can only afford to have three full-time staff, and I know this. They rely on volunteers for everything else.

However, they did give me excellent recommendations, and they helped point me in the direction of other similar organizations that might be hiring. The experience also looked good on my resume because it was in my field of study.
